Freecycle how long to wait giving to the next one

Options
Put three pairs of curtains on freecycle and a few people respnded so offered them to the first who emailed, they asked if they could collect on Sunday, I replied with some times to choose from and also asked if they wanted to take them in a large box or bin bags, No reply so I asked again today, no reply so I asked if they still wanted them again no reply. Do I give them more time or offerto the next who responded now.

    I respond to someone who shows some interest in the item.
    1. I'd like the (item)
    2. Some words about why they'd like it
    3. When they can collect.
    People who just say 'I'm interested' don't have a hope! There are paople who claim everything offered.
    If people don't turn up, it's difficult because there may be a good reason, so I send a message to them to say I'll hold it for 24 hours.
